In the spring I shall be getting a great plains rat snake, he shall be called cecil. I am wondering about his cage though. they like to climb more than corns right? should i get him a tall viv rather than a long one?
 
Ours did climb a bit when young but as an adult - spend all their time under their hidebox. It was always my impression that great plains ratsnakes were less likely to climb than corns - not that many trees on the praries!
